Absence of Appropriate Preparation



Lack of correct planning is a typical pitfall that lots of house owners fall under when embarking on a home enhancement task. Without a clear plan in place, you may experience hold-ups, unforeseen expenses, and a result that doesn't meet your assumptions. To avoid this error, begin by plainly defining your objectives for the addition.

Take into consideration just how you'll use the new space and what functions are crucial for your needs. Next, collaborate with a specialist architect or developer to create in-depth strategies that outline the layout, products, and overall layout of the addition. Make sure to get any kind of required permits before beginning building and construction to stop legal issues in the future.

Additionally, make the effort to develop a reasonable timeline for the task. Rushing via the preparation stage can result in mistakes throughout building and construction, costing you time and money in the future. By spending time ahead of time to intend extensively, you can make sure a smoother and much more successful home addition project.

Overlooking Spending Plan Constraints



Appropriate monetary preparation is essential to the success of your home addition task. When embarking on a home addition, it's essential to develop a sensible spending plan and adhere to it.

One common error home owners make is ignoring the prices involved in a home enhancement. It's vital to think about not only the preliminary construction costs but additionally prospective unforeseen costs that may arise during the task.

To prevent overlooking budget plan restraints, start by defining your budget based on extensive research and obtaining multiple quotes from professionals. Keep in mind to include permits, materials, labor, and any added costs in your budget computations.

Be prepared for unpredicted expenses by setting aside a backup fund that goes to the very least 10-20% of your complete budget plan.

Regularly check your expenses throughout the job to guarantee you remain within spending plan. Be open to making adjustments if essential to avoid overspending.

Disregarding Zoning Rules



Failing to follow zoning guidelines can bring about expensive hold-ups and complications in your house addition project. Zoning guidelines dictate just how residential or commercial properties can be used and what sort of frameworks can be built in specific areas. By ignoring these laws, you take the chance of encountering fines, needing to renovate job, or perhaps halting your job completely. It's vital to research study and comprehend the zoning legislations in your area prior to beginning any type of building and construction.



Failing to abide by zoning policies can cause your task being closed down by regional authorities. This can't only squander your time and money however also trigger stress and anxiety.

Prior to making any strategies or changes to your home, check with your neighborhood zoning office to ensure that your project straightens with the policies in place.
